OCM BOCES Social Media Comment Guidelines

All official Onondaga-Cortland-Madison BOCES (OCM BOCES) social media pages will focus on celebrating and supporting our students, staff, campuses and programs, as well as sharing important news and communicating event information. We encourage you to share your support, connect with other supporters, and visit frequently for news and updates. While every

one is welcome and encouraged to comment, our first priority is to protect students, staff and community members. Comments and/or posts that do not follow these Comment Guidelines may be removed. We have zero tolerance for cyberbullying and/or posts or comments that are political, racist, sexist, abusive, profane, violent, obscene, spam, contain falsehoods or are wildly off-topic, or that libel, incite, threaten or make ad hominem attacks on students, employees, guests or other individuals. We also do not permit messages selling products or promoting commercial or other ventures. You participate at your own risk, taking personal responsibility for your comments, your username and any information provided. We reserve the right to delete comments or topics and even ban users, if needed. Please be aware that all content and posts are bound by Facebook’s Terms of Use. OCM BOCES encourages user interaction on its social pages, but is not responsible for comments or wall postings made by visitors to the page. Additionally, the appearance of external links, as posted by fans of this page or other Facebook users, does not constitute endorsement on behalf of OCM BOCES. In most if not all cases, external links posted by fans will be removed. You should not provide private or personal information (phone, email, addresses etc.) regarding yourself or others on this page. Any posts or comments containing personal information of this nature will be deleted.

Congratulations to our 15 high school diploma graduates and 76 workforce training graduates who walked across the stage last night at West Genesee High School for this summer's OCM BOCES graduation ceremony! 🎓

The auditorium was packed with family, friends, OCM BOCES teachers, administrators and staff, and other supporters who came together to cheer on and celebrate our graduates and their accomplishments.

Our workforce training graduates represented several high-demand programs, including Construction Trades, Electrical Maintenance Technician, HVAC/R, Medical Assisting, and Welder/Fitter.

All of their accomplishments were especially meaningful because, as adult students, many are balancing families, jobs and other responsibilities alongside their education. We could not be more proud of the dedication and perseverance it took to reach this milestone!

We wish all of our graduates the very best as they begin this next chapter. As several speakers reminded us last night, keep learning, keep growing — your education never ends! 👏

👏👏Teachers of multilingual learners explored two essential questions today during an all-day professional development session organized by our very own Mid-State Regional Bilingual Education Resource Network (RBERN):

1.) Where can AI help us remove barriers and create greater access for multilingual learners?
2.) Where does our professional judgment remain essential?

Special guests at the DoubleTree by Hilton Hotel in East Syracuse included keynote speakers and authors Dr. Carol Salva and Dr. Valentina Gonzalez, along with featured speaker Dr. Marie Heath. Together, they shared inspirational stories, the highlights of their books, and research-based strategies for supporting multilingual learners in an AI-powered world.

Breakout sessions connected educators with the expertise of our instructional technology specialists from the OCM BOCES Model Schools team, who explored digital tools such as Google’s NotebookLM and Kami, the art of AI prompting, and ways to personalize instruction with AI.

🐾 A new opportunity for students interested in veterinary science is officially underway!

Thank you to everyone who joined us yesterday evening at the Veterinary Medical Center of Central New York to celebrate the launch of our brand-new OCM BOCES Veterinary Science Career & Technical Education (CTE) program!

We’re excited to welcome our inaugural class of 10 juniors from school districts across our region.

What makes this program so exciting? Students will learn inside a working emergency and specialty veterinary hospital, gaining experience alongside Licensed Veterinary Technicians and other veterinary medical professionals.

Throughout the program, students will:

✅Learn in areas including Emergency & Critical Care, Surgery, Radiology and Rehabilitation

✅Take part in clinical rotations and shadow veterinary staff

✅ Earn high school academic credits, with potential college credit

✅ Work toward certifications in Animal CPR, First Aid and Fear Free handling

A special thank you to the Ann Harris Initiative for partnering with us and supporting this new opportunity for students and the veterinary community in Central New York.

🚀 FIRST LEGO League coaches from across the region recently joined us at our Main Campus for the annual FIRST LEGO League Coaches Camp, hosted by the OCM BOCES Model Schools program.

It was a great opportunity for coaches to share ideas and get ready for another season of helping students explore STEM through teamwork, creativity and problem-solving.

Through Model Schools, educators and administrators have access to more than 100 professional learning opportunities each year, including hands-on workshops, digital courses, specialized meetings, user groups and customized support.

We’re proud to support the educators who help students turn curiosity into something they can build, test and bring to life!
